Spicy garlic butter shrimp

Perfect for meal prep, this dish combines succulent shrimp with a kick of sriracha and savory Japanese BBQ sauce.
Prep Time 10 minutes mins
Cook Time 20 minutes mins
Servings 4
Calories 392 kcal
- 1 lb shrimp head off, tail on, deveined
- 3 tbsp butter
- 4 garlic minced
- 2 scallion (green and white) chopped
- 1-2 tbsp sriracha
- 2-3 tbsp Spicy Japanese Barbecue Sauce (Bachan brand)
- creole seasoning if needed
Start by patting the shrimp dry with a paper towel. This helps them sear nicely in the pan.
In a large skillet,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té until fragrant, about 1-2 minutes. Be careful not to burn the garlic.
Increase the heat to medium-high and add the scallion and shrimp to the skillet. Cook for 2-3 minutes on each side, until they turn pink and opaque.
Stir in the sriracha and spicy Japanese barbecue sauce, coating the shrimp evenly. Cook for another 1-2 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ld together. Sprinkle creole seasoning if needed.
Remove the skillet from heat and sprinkle the chopped scallions over the shrimp.
Serve the spicy butter garlic shrimp over a bed of cooked rice. Garnish with extra scallions or a squeeze of lime if desired.
